Categories
Featured-Post-Software-EN Software Engineering (EN)

How to Recruit Developers in Estonia: A Strategic Guide for Businesses

Auteur n°4 – Mariami

By Mariami Minadze
Views: 4

Summary – In the face of the Swiss developer shortage and cost, time and compliance pressures, Estonia stands out with a pool of 22,000 trained IT professionals, an advanced digital ecosystem (e-Residency, incubators) and high English proficiency. Mapping the main hubs, applying a rigorous selection process (technical test, soft skills assessment, pilot sprint), complying with legal requirements and GDPR, and adopting agile management are essential to avoid turnover, cost overruns and compliance risks. Adopting a managed dedicated team model – Swiss governance with controlled offshore delivery – guarantees quality, service continuity and flexibility without administrative complexity.

The scarcity of IT talent in Switzerland and Western Europe is pushing many companies to explore new skill pools. Estonia, with its advanced digital culture and strategic location between Western Europe and Russia, is attracting particular attention.

Thanks to initiatives like e-Residency and a digitalized business environment, this small Baltic nation offers a pool of 22,000 IT professionals and tech exports worth USD 2.68 billion. Yet the challenge remains to ensure reliable delivery capacity, compliant with Swiss and European standards, while controlling costs and timelines.

Strategic Stakes and Overview of the Estonian IT Market

Estonia combines a strong digital culture with a business-friendly environment, addressing pressure on costs and deadlines. However, tapping into this talent pool requires a detailed understanding of its advantages and dynamics.

Shortage Context and Estonia’s Strengths

Faced with a developer shortage in Switzerland, Estonia stands out for its massive investment in IT training. Technical universities and local boot camps produce a steady stream of specialized profiles every year.

Political stability, a low digital divide, and the rise of startups contribute to an innovative ecosystem. Authorities also promote streamlined procedures for high-tech companies.

Example: a Swiss industrial SME recruited a small team of Estonian developers to accelerate its IoT platform project. This collaboration demonstrated that, despite a limited time difference, the local team could deliver sprints at a consistent pace, ensuring on-time market launches.

Key Figures of the Estonian Talent Pool

With 22,000 digital professionals and 3,400 IT companies, Estonia’s digital sector enjoys an annual growth rate of 8.6%.

Core specialties include web development (PHP, ASP.NET), back-end (Python, Node.js), and DevOps.

The English proficiency index scores 570, classified as “High Proficiency,” facilitating communication with foreign teams.

The Estonian model also relies on public–private incubators and acceleration programs that feed tech exports. SMEs and startups benefit from a network of partners and shared resources.

e-Residency and Attraction for International Talent

e-Residency allows foreign entrepreneurs to create and manage a company in Estonia remotely. This initiative has attracted over 80,000 digital residents, including tech freelancers.

For Swiss companies, this means simplified access to freelancers who are often already familiar with European data privacy and security standards.

However, it’s important to remember that these freelancers may be engaged on multiple projects. To secure continuous delivery capacity, a structured engagement model remains preferable.

Mapping Talent and Legal Framework for Employment in Estonia

The distribution of IT skills varies significantly across Estonian cities, as do salary levels. Understanding these disparities and the legal framework is crucial for managing an offshore project.

Characteristics of Key Hubs

Tallinn, the capital, hosts 40% of the talent and offers an average salary of USD 6,000/month for a senior developer, driven by a dynamic R&D sector and startups.

Tartu, the second university center, offers salaries around USD 5,300/month, with a pool of recent graduates trained in .NET and Python technologies.

Example: a financial services SME chose a Tallinn–Pärnu mix to balance costs and expertise. This multi-site strategy proved effective for managing workload peaks while optimizing payroll expenses.

Estonia’s Employment Law

Labor law requires a written contract, a legal working week of 40 hours, and an annual minimum wage set by law. Overtime is compensated at higher rates and strictly regulated.

Social contributions include health insurance and pension, totaling approximately 33% of the gross salary paid by the employer. Paid leave amounts to 28 working days per year.

An open-ended contract remains standard, but flexible arrangements through umbrella companies or subcontracting can be considered, subject to GDPR and IP compliance.

GDPR, Intellectual Property, and Confidentiality Obligations

As a member of the European Union, Estonia strictly enforces the GDPR. Data processing clauses and access traceability must be defined from the outset in the contract.

Intellectual property protection relies on the local Copyright Act, aligned with EU directives. Rights assignments or licenses must be explicitly stated.

For critical projects, regular compliance audits and robust confidentiality agreements are recommended, especially when handling sensitive data.

Edana: international teams, Swiss framework.

With its head office in Switzerland and its presence in Eastern Europe, Edana offers dedicated teams that are high-performing, cost-effective, and worthy of the highest standards.

Recruitment Best Practices and Pitfalls to Avoid

Hiring an isolated profile in Estonia without proper oversight exposes companies to hidden costs and continuity risks. A structured selection process and rigorous management are indispensable.

Risks of Isolated Hiring

A lone freelancer or developer may seem less expensive initially, but managing leave, turnover, and documentation generates significant hidden costs.

In case of absence or departure, the project can stall for weeks, jeopardizing the roadmap and increasing emergency fix costs.

Example: a logistics company hired a freelance developer in Estonia. After six months, the developer joined a competitor, leaving the project on hold and forcing the company into an urgent recruitment process.

Rigorous Selection Process

The first technical step involves a coding test to validate skills in the required language (PHP, Node.js, Ruby…).

A judgment-and-problem-solving interview assesses the candidate’s ability to communicate in English and fit an agile culture. Soft skills are as crucial as technical expertise.

Finally, a short pilot sprint (2 to 4 weeks) provides a real vision of productivity and collaboration before any long-term commitment.

Agile Management and Governance

Implementing daily rituals (stand-ups, demos, retrospectives) ensures visibility and responsiveness. Clear KPIs (velocity, bug rate, deadline compliance) must be monitored.

A part-time business liaison or Scrum Master coordinates communication, manages priorities, and prevents scope creep.

Transparency relies on a shared project management tool (Jira, Trello) accessible to both Swiss and Estonian teams. Regular reports ensure constant alignment.

Managed Dedicated Offshore Team Model

Classic staff augmentation or unmanaged offshore models can compromise technical consistency and timeline control. The Managed Dedicated Team offers a reliable alternative.

Limitations of Traditional Engagement Models

Direct overseas hiring or uncontrolled offshore outsourcing exposes companies to variable quality, high turnover, and complex coordination.

Freelance, staff augmentation, or establishing a development center require strong internal resources for management and business analysis, increasing administrative burdens.

Hidden costs related to documentation backlog, delays, and cultural conflict management can outweigh salary savings.

Introducing the Edana Model

Managed Dedicated Team proposed by Edana: a structured pool (developer, part-time project manager, part-time QA, part-time technical lead) dedicated full-time to each client.

The Swiss head office ensures governance, business analysis, delivery quality, and business alignment. The Georgian branch, under direct control, handles operational delivery.

Each team is sized according to project needs: flexible allocations, continuous skill development, and no HR or administrative management for the client.

Concrete Benefits and Scalable Flexibility

This model delivers consistent technical reliability, service continuity, and controlled timelines, without risk of knowledge loss.

Scalable flexibility allows adding or removing resources based on project progress, without long-term contract commitments or administrative complexity.

Centralized coordination in Switzerland ensures transparent reporting and quick adjustments based on business feedback.

Structuring Your Offshore Delivery Capacity with a Managed Dedicated Team

Estonia offers an attractive IT talent pool thanks to its digital ecosystem, specialized hubs, and an EU-aligned legal framework. However, success depends first and foremost on governance, agile management, and a structured model.

To ensure quality, continuity, and flexibility, the Managed Dedicated Team approach – with a Swiss head office for governance and controlled execution in Eastern Europe – represents the most robust solution.

Our experts are available to discuss your needs, define the right team structure, and secure your offshore projects.

Discuss your challenges with an Edana expert

By Mariami

Project Manager

PUBLISHED BY

Mariami Minadze

Mariami is an expert in digital strategy and project management. She audits the digital ecosystems of companies and organizations of all sizes and in all sectors, and orchestrates strategies and plans that generate value for our customers. Highlighting and piloting solutions tailored to your objectives for measurable results and maximum ROI is her specialty.

FAQ

Frequently Asked Questions about Recruiting in Estonia

What are the strategic advantages of hiring developers in Estonia?

Estonia combines a strong digital culture, a pool of 22,000 IT professionals, and a digitized business environment (e-Residency). The country has a high level of English proficiency and an attractive tax model for high-tech companies. Recruiting in Estonia helps alleviate the local shortage in Switzerland, while ensuring a respected time-to-market and access to profiles trained in the latest open source technologies.

Which technical profiles are most available in Estonia?

Web developers (PHP, ASP.NET), back-end developers (Python, Node.js), and DevOps engineers are the most represented in the Estonian market. Local technical universities and bootcamps ensure a steady flow of recent graduates. You will also find experts in open source solutions, GDPR compliance, and cloud architectures, tailored to Swiss and European standards.

How do you handle the legal and regulatory aspects for an Estonian employee?

Estonian labor law requires a written contract, a 40-hour workweek, and social contributions of around 33% of the gross salary. Paid leave is 28 working days. You can opt for a permanent contract (CDI) or a flexible model via an umbrella company, while complying with GDPR obligations and intellectual property clauses.

What are the salary specifics and social costs to anticipate?

The average salary for an experienced developer ranges between USD 5,300/month in Tartu and USD 6,000/month in Tallinn. Employer social contributions amount to about 33% of the gross salary, including health insurance and pension. These figures vary according to expertise level and location of your resources.

What risks are involved in hiring an Estonian freelancer in isolation?

Hiring a freelancer without a structure exposes you to high turnover, unavailability, and re-engagement costs. In case of departure, your project can stall for several weeks. Additionally, without agile management and thorough documentation, continuity and technical quality are compromised.

How do you structure an effective selection process for Estonia?

Combine a technical coding test, an English interview focused on problem-solving, and a pilot mini-project of 2 to 4 weeks. This approach validates skills, communication, and agile fit before any long-term commitment, while minimizing risks related to cultural and organizational differences.

Which KPIs should you track when managing an offshore Estonian team?

Track velocity (story points delivered), bug detection rate, sprint deadline compliance, and average incident resolution time. Supplement with internal satisfaction rate (stakeholder feedback) to ensure delivery is aligned with your objectives and collaboration remains transparent.

How do you ensure GDPR compliance and intellectual property protection?

Incorporate precise clauses in the contract regarding data handling and traceability in accordance with GDPR, and explicitly mention copyright assignments under the Estonian Copyright Act. Plan regular audits and strong confidentiality agreements to safeguard sensitive information.

CONTACT US

They trust us

Let’s talk about you

Describe your project to us, and one of our experts will get back to you.

SUBSCRIBE

Don’t miss our strategists’ advice

Get our insights, the latest digital strategies and best practices in digital transformation, innovation, technology and cybersecurity.

Let’s turn your challenges into opportunities

Based in Geneva, Edana designs tailor-made digital solutions for companies and organizations seeking greater competitiveness.

We combine strategy, consulting, and technological excellence to transform your business processes, customer experience, and performance.

Let’s discuss your strategic challenges.

022 596 73 70

Agence Digitale Edana sur LinkedInAgence Digitale Edana sur InstagramAgence Digitale Edana sur Facebook